The US Army Rangers Flag: Symbolism and History

us army rangers flag

The US Army Rangers Flag holds profound symbolism and a rich history within the military community. Designed to represent the elite Ranger units, it features distinct elements that pay tribute to their exceptional capabilities and achievements. At its core, the flag often incorporates the iconic army green beret insignia, symbolizing the special forces nature of these soldiers. This emblem is a powerful reminder of the Rangers’ unique training, skill set, and readiness for high-risk missions.

The history of the Rangers Flag traces back to the early days of American military operations, where specialized units were formed to conduct unconventional warfare. Over time, the Ranger Division banners have evolved, reflecting changes in tactics and technology. Today, the flag stands as a symbol of pride and camaraderie among Rangers, embodying their legacy of bravery, precision, and dedication to serving their country.

How to Display the Rangers Flag Properly

us army rangers flag

Displaying the US Army Rangers Flag properly is a sign of respect and honor to those who serve and have served in this elite unit. When raising or displaying the Rangers Flag, ensure it’s at the same height as other flags present and flown from a staff or halyard, never hung vertically. The flag should be flown daily during daylight hours, and if weather permits, it should remain up year-round.

For indoor displays, the flag should be hung in a prominent location where it can be seen easily by all. It’s important to keep the flag clean and well-maintained, regularly inspecting for any signs of wear or damage. When handling the Rangers Flag, always use proper etiquette, treating it with the same respect you would give to a service member still wearing their green beret training uniform or participating in rangers special operations group missions. This includes never allowing the flag to touch the ground and always folding it neatly when stored.
